Vivid cerise

Vivid cerise # Imagination

Parameters:
HEX Triplet:
#da1d81
RGB:
218, 29, 129
CMYK:
0, 87, 41, 15
HSL:
328.3°, 76.5%, 48.4%

What superhero can be dressed in Vivid cerise?

One possible superhero who can be dressed in Vivid cerise is Starfire from the DC Comics universe.
Starfire is an alien princess from the planet Tamaran who has the ability to fly and shoot starbolts from her hands.
She is a member of the Teen Titans and a close friend of Robin, Cyborg, Raven, and Beast Boy.
Starfire's costume is usually a purple bikini with metallic accents, but she has also worn other outfits that feature Vivid cerise as a dominant color.
For example, in the animated series Teen Titans Go!, she wears a long-sleeved dress with a high collar and a belt that are both Vivid cerise.
In the live-action series Titans, she wears a fur coat and a dress that are also Vivid cerise.
Starfire's hair is also a bright shade of pink that resembles Vivid cerise.
Starfire is a cheerful, optimistic, and compassionate superhero who values friendship and peace.
She is also very powerful and can fight against enemies such as Deathstroke, Trigon, and Blackfire.
Starfire is one of the most popular and beloved superheroes in the DC Comics universe.
